Government of Canada Supports Canada Day Celebrations in Kawartha Lakes

ID: 1361058

Funding from the Celebrate Canada program helps make community event possible

(firmenpresse) - LINDSAY, ONTARIO -- (Marketwired) -- 05/25/15 -- Department of Canadian Heritage

Barry Devolin, Member of Parliament (Haliburton-Kawartha Lakes-Brock), on behalf of the Honourable Shelly Glover, Minister of Canadian Heritage and Official Languages, today announced $27,200 in funding to the City of Kawartha Lakes to celebrate Canada Day.

This funding, provided through the Celebrate Canada program, will enable the organization to offer Canada Day activities in the Kawartha Lakes area on July 1, 2015.

"Canada Day in Kawartha Lakes is always a much enjoyed and appreciated event for thousands of residents, visitors, families and children. In celebration of Canada''s birthday, a series of events and activities are held across the municipality to represent the history and culture of our diverse towns and villages. Providing parades, entertainment, activities for kids and families, lots of food, and stunning fireworks displays, Canada Day events in Kawartha Lakes are our way of saying thanks to all the people of our municipality and to provide family-focused parties in celebration of our great nation."





-Andy Letham, Mayor, City of Kawartha Lakes
